    Thanks, John!

    This is it! Set-up day is today from 4:30 p.m. to 7 p.m.., tomorrow from 9 a.m. to 11 a.m.. Our room will be stuffed with 25 to 30 exhibits with computers ranging from Commodore 8-bit machines to Amigas (including a Sam440) to even a Nabu PC! The
    presentations are set, though the door prizes are in a state of flux. Whether ready or not, PaCommEx officially starts tomorrow (Saturday) at 11 a.m. until 5 p.m. when we head off to dinner. Hey, if people want to spend more time on Saturday after 5 p.
    m. at the show, we can do that! We repeat on Sunday but must close on time at 5 p.m., because another party will be coming in that evening.
